Factors and Pathways Modulating Endothelial Cell Senescence in Vascular Aging
4 Sept 2022
Abstract excerpt
Aging causes a progressive decline in the structure and function of organs. With advancing age, an accumulation of senescent endothelial cells (ECs) contributes to the risk of developing vascular dysfunction and cardiovascular diseases, including hypertension, diabetes, atherosclerosis, and neurodegeneration.
